Abstract

Educational robotics has long been proved an effective tool to enhance teaching effectiveness in scientific fields such as mathematics, physics, engineering, and computer science. Teachers working in a robotics classroom, however, face difficulty in the identification of the needs for proper interventions to the students’ learning processes. To tackle this problem, we proposed and implemented an agency architecture which uses software agents to monitor the student activities and robot movements. The implementation is multi-agent based and distributed across a network of student terminals as well as the teacher terminal. As a result, both promising prospects and limitations are revealed in this implementation.
